People'S Bank of Commerce Review

People's Bank of Commerce is a community-focused FDIC-insured bank that emphasizes putting customers first. The bank operates multiple branches primarily in the Oregon region, with documented locations in Medford and Central Point, and maintains both physical and digital banking infrastructure. S.

Government through FDIC insurance. The bank offers a comprehensive suite of financial products including personal checking and savings accounts, business checking accounts tailored to commercial needs, credit cards, online banking with 24/7 account access, and small business lending through their dedicated lending center. They feature specialized products such as Quick Flex Business and Nonprofit Loans for amounts of $25,000 or less, a new nonprofit program with fee-free accounts, and the PB Roundup Program—a debit card-based savings tool.

Treasury management services, investor relations support, and QuickBooks Direct Connect integration are also available. The bank provides career opportunities and maintains accessibility features including screen-reader compatibility. What distinguishes People's Bank of Commerce is their explicit focus on nonprofit organizations and small businesses, including fee-free accounts specifically for nonprofit entities and small business lending tailored to organizations with limited financing options.

They offer QuickBooks integration for business customers and emphasize personal relationship banking through knowledgeable commercial loan officers. The bank's community-oriented approach and regional presence suggest a personal touch compared to national megabanks. As a traditional community bank, People's Bank of Commerce serves customers seeking FDIC-insured deposit accounts and business lending from a locally-focused institution.

Their strength lies in serving small businesses and nonprofits with personalized service, though customers seeking extensive branch networks or advanced fintech features may need to consider larger competitors. Mortgage Lending Transparency

People'S Bank of Commerce processed 148 mortgage applications in 2023, approving 91.9% of applicants across 4 states.

148

Applications

91.9%

Approval Rate

$482K

Avg Loan

4

States Served

Approval Rate by Applicant Income

Under $50K
80%
$50K–$100K
85.7%
$100K–$200K
91.5%
Over $200K
100%

Based on 148 applications. Income in thousands (reported by applicant).

Top Lending States

Oregon 141 apps · 94.3%
Nevada 1 apps · 100%
California 1 apps · 100%
Washington 1 apps · 100%

Source: CFPB Home Mortgage Disclosure Act (HMDA) Data, 2023. Applications include originated, approved, and denied loans.
